Unit Leader – Experimental and Molecular Medicine
About the Institute
The Institute of Obesity Research was established to generate cutting‐edge knowledge through scientific rigor and analysis, developing innovative ideas and solutions to the obesity problem through interdisciplinary and transdisciplinary work, and creating scientific‐technological companies to improve the health and well‐being of people and society.
Role and Vision
Design, lead, and execute high‐impact translational research in obesity and metabolic diseases, integrating molecular biology, experimental models, and clinical validation.
In this position, bridging the gap between scientific discoveries and their clinical applications is key.
Contribute to positioning the Institute as a reference in Mexico and LATAM in biomedical research with health impact.
